Automated Valet offers recession incentive to operations with old valet systems

Plantation, Fla. January 2009 -- As the economic environment fluctuates in the United States and around the world Automated Valet is offering its clients a much needed break. Free software upgrades and features are just part of the program the company is rolling out to support those on the front lines of the parking industry.
With Automated Valets superior automation system, AVPM, will be more accessible to valet operations with no compromise in service or quality.

For operations that have a system with older technology, Automated Valet is offering a recession incentive program including discounts on products and features. And the company will provide free upgrades to its software.
Trade Show.pngAutomated Valet Founder and CEO Ken Gulec says now is the best time to invest in technology and equipment and replace any system with 20-year-old technology with our award-winning system.

"Every dollar counts during difficult times, revenue control is more important than ever, and no matter what is going on with the economy, customers expect good service", Gulec says. "Our automation system optimizes service and has an immediate effect on revenue control. We can guarantee an increase in revenue within days of installation and training with AVPM."

Technology award winner AVPM provides 100 percent revenue control with features including validation tracking and ticket inventory, extensive reporting capabilities, and digital-video technology that almost eliminates false claims. Not only that, biometric clock in/out procedures safeguard payroll by recording employees arrivals and departures with their fingerprints.
AVPM comes with full and uninterrupted technological support from Automated Valet. The system never goes down so maintenance and operation issues are addressed nearly instantaneously. The systems user interface is straightforward and easy to train.
Gulec says he recognizes the changes in the financial climate affect everyone. He hopes the Recession Incentive Program Automated Valet has created will bolster the mood and the overall success of those in the business of valet parking.
"We have a strong background in the industry and a great product. We feel it is our responsibility to help out," he says.
